HP (Hewlett-Packard) HP 3100 Fax Machine User Manual


 
3Fax
You can use the HP Fax to send and receive faxes, including color faxes. You can
schedule faxes to be sent at a later time and set up speed-dials to send faxes quickly and
easily to frequently used numbers. From the control panel, you can also set a number of
fax options, such as resolution and the contrast between lightness and darkness on the
faxes you send.
NOTE: Before you begin faxing, make sure you have set up the HP Fax properly for
faxing.
You can verify the fax is set up correctly by running the fax setup test from the control
panel. To run the fax test, press Setup, select Tools, select Run fax test, and then press
OK.

Send a fax
You can send a fax in a variety of ways. Using the control panel, you can send a black-
and-white or color fax. You can also initiate a fax manually from an external phone. This
allows you to speak with the recipient before sending the fax.

Send a fax manually from a phone
Sending a fax manually allows you to make a phone call and talk with the recipient before
you send the fax. This is useful if you want to inform the recipient that you are going to
send them a fax before sending it. When you send a fax manually, you can hear the dial
tones, telephone prompts, or other sounds through the handset on your telephone. This
makes it easy for you to use a calling card to send your fax.
Depending on how the recipient has their fax machine set up, the recipient might answer
the phone, or the fax machine might take the call. If a person answers the phone, you
